Output 571d244d894611c27e2e95bf2eb47a59a8cef59cd80f0fc5429cf5464ff67c81:1

value
104444
script pubkey
OP_0 OP_PUSHBYTES_20 d20603240f18179daf7357f641ef5490cd8370bd
address
bc1q6grqxfq0rqtemtmn2lmyrm65jrxcxu9agh5ueu
transaction
571d244d894611c27e2e95bf2eb47a59a8cef59cd80f0fc5429cf5464ff67c81
confirmations
37630
spent
true